Method
Baked Item (choose one)
- 1
Warm croissant
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Place croissant on a baking sheet and warm for 5–7 minutes until heated through and slightly crisp on the outside. Remove and serve with 1 tbs butter and 1 tsp jam on the side.
- 2
Warm muffin
If muffin chosen, warm in a 325°F (160°C) oven for 6–8 minutes (or microwave for 20–30 seconds) until just heated through. Serve with 1 tbs butter and 1 tsp jam.
Grain Bowl (choose one)
- 3
Hot oatmeal
Combine 1 cup rolled oats, 1.5 cups milk or water and a pinch of salt in a small saucepan. Bring to a gentle boil over medium heat, stirring occasionally, then reduce to a simmer and cook 5–7 minutes until thickened to desired consistency. Remove from heat and let sit 1 minute.

Dairy & Fruit
- 6
Measure 0.5 cups Greek yogurt into a small serving bowl or ramekin. Spoon fresh mixed fruit (3 oz) alongside the yogurt or arrange on top. Sprinkle 2 tbsp additional berries for garnish if desired.

Juice
Pour 6 oz chilled fruit juice (orange or apple) into a glass and serve chilled.
Finishing & Plating
- 10
Assemble the plate: place warmed croissant or muffin on a plate with butter and jam. Add the chosen grain (oatmeal in a bowl, or cold cereal/granola in a separate bowl). Place Greek yogurt with fresh fruit adjacent to the grain bowl. Serve juice in a glass and coffee or tea in a cup. Offer honey and extra fruit on the side to taste.
